Property Location When you stay at Naksel Boutique Hotel & Spa in Paro, you'll be 10 minutes by car from Kyichu Lhakhang. This 4.5-star hotel is 6.3 mi (10.2 km) from Rinpung Dzong and 6.5 mi (10.4 km) from Bhutan National Museum. Rooms Make yourself at home in one of the 38 guestrooms featuring minibars. Complimentary wireless Intern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have shower/tub combinations and complimentary toiletries. Conveniences include safes and desks, and housekeeping is provided daily. Dining Enjoy a meal at the restaurant, or stay in and take advantage of the hotel's room service (during limited hours).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ily from 7:30 AM to 9 AM. Business, Other Amenities Featured amenities include a business center, dry cleaning/laundry services, and a 24-hour front desk. Free self parking is available onsite.Mostra di più

Naksel was both our first and last accomodation in Bhutan, and it was the perfect bookend to a wonderful trip. The hotel is set high up a hillside on the outskirts of town, this provides with you stunning views across the valley, including Tiger's Nest and Jomolhari Mountain. The smaller cabins circle the main building, which houses the family room, business centre, lobby kitchens etc. The grounds themselves are beautiful, carts are available if the mild hills prove too steep for luggage. We stayed in the family room and it was simply gorgeous. Floor to ceiling windows make the most of the view, with a large living area and beds available for my family of four. The room was large, but cosy and warm - which wasn't the case everywhere in Bhutan. The heated tiles in the bathroom were an especial treat, as was the huge bathtub after a long day hiking. Food at the restaurant was a nice mix of Bhutanese, Western and Indian styles. It was always generous - extremely so! - and the quality was good. We enjoyed a hot stone bath to relax at the spa. However the best thing about Naksel is the service. Staff are incredibly helpful, friendly, attentive, thoughtful. We were taken up for an impromptu archery lesson one afternoon, the bar man treated me to some of the local spirit, ara, one night. Everyone was so friendly. I always felt cared for. When we come back to Bhutan I will definitely stay here.

I was in Bhutan for 10 days and wanted to finish the trip with a better hotel near the Tigers Nest and that is why I selected the Naksel. This was my choice rather than the suggested hotel from the guide. I’m not quite sure how it gets its 4* star rating or what quite qualifies it to call itself luxury and boutique. It reminds me of 1970s ski lodges with a lot of pine and it does have that old-fashioned feel about it. We were greeted with a lukewarm drink upon arrival and I was disappointed to find that the security lock to the bedroom was broken and that the room safe opened with a standard default number. That means anyone could open your safe if they had access to your room. The double bed in the bedroom was very small despite having adequate room for a larger one. The toiletries in the bathroom were of a budget quality and certainly didn’t reflect what the hotel was trying to achieve. The pillows on the bed were of a cheap foam and not particularly comfortable. There was only one toilet roll in the bathroom which ran out. The bar area was pleasant with a nice terrace outside with good views, however there were no cushions or blankets on any of the chairs. You would struggle to sit out there in the cool weather. There was also a nice room on the terrace with a log burner but it was hopeless trying to use it as the fire was never lit. There also no fresh flowers anywhere or complementary fruit etc which is unusual for a hotel that calls its self 4* star and luxury. The nuts that were served with my apéritif prior to dinner were the standard that you would probably feed your hamster. This was the only place in my 10 day trip where all the prices were quoted in US dollars which is strange for a country that wants to maintain its own identity. It was also adds another 10% service and 10% tax to all bills. It called itself a spa but the spa was slightly away from the hotel and nothing was included in the room rate. Usually a steam room or sauna would be included in your price. The restaurant was alright but unfortunately breakfast finished by 9 am . There was also no fresh fruit on one of the days and the jams available were the cheapest catering ones you could ever find. It would be so easy to improve this place but until then I would say somewhere else on my next trip.
